Nashville International Airport, also known as BNA, is not only a convenient travel hub, but it is also a paradise for beer lovers. With outlets from five local breweries, including Fat Bottom Brewing, Little Harpeth Brewing, TailGate Brewery, Tennessee Brew Works, and Yazoo Brewing Company, the airport offers a diverse selection of craft beers. Founded in 1981 as an international wine competition, the Beverage Testing Institute grew to include beer, spirits, cider, and sake evaluations in 1994. The organization’s mission expanded to ongoing product evaluations, conforming to ASTM standards.
